141,204,812,193,900 is an even composite number composed of six prime numbers multiplied together.

What does the number 141204812193900 look like?

This visualization shows the relationship between its 6 prime factors (large circles) and 1512 divisors.

141204812193900 is an even composite number. It is composed of six distinct prime numbers multiplied together. It has a total of one thousand, five hundred twelve divisors.

Prime factorization of 141204812193900:

22 × 32 × 52 × 76 × 133 × 607

(2 × 2 × 3 × 3 × 5 × 5 × 7 × 7 × 7 × 7 × 7 × 7 × 13 × 13 × 13 × 607)
